Bobby R King
March 20, 2014
Funeral for Bobby R King, 76, of Hartselle will be Sat., March 22, at 11 a.m. at Peck Funeral Home Chapel with the Rev. Wayne Penn officiating and Peck Funeral Home directing.
Burial will be in Mt Zion Cemetery. Visitation will be Fri., March 21, from 6 to 8 p.m. at the funeral home.
Mr. King died on Thur., March 20, 2014, at Decatur Morgan Hospital. He was born April 13, 1937, in Morgan County to Gilbert Eugene King, Sr. and Mary Eugie Ward King. He was a member and deacon of Mt. Zion Baptist Church. He retired from Monsanto in 1992 after 36 years of service and he owned and operated Kings Antiques. He loved his children and grandchildren dearly. Mr. King was preceded in death by a brother, Gilbert Eugene King; and a sister, Hilma Murphy.
He is survived by his wife of 56 years, Carrie Lee Thompson King of Hartselle; two daughters, Belinda Ealey (Larry) of Hartselle and Kimberley King of Decatur; a brother, Ronnie King (Linda) of Hartselle; four sisters, Ruth Burch of Hartselle, Shirley Howard (Sonny) of Huntsville, Betty Randolph (Gerald) of Texas and Nell Dobbins (Bobby) of Hartselle; four grandchildren, John Hardin, James Hardin, Brandon Colwell and Brandy Hyche; two great-grandchildren, James Hyche and Aubrey Hyche
Pallbearers will be Dale Burch, Tim Tucker, Jason Hyche, Todd Thompson, Tim Sivley and Bobby Dobbins.
Honorary pallbearers will be grandsons.
In lieu of flowers, family requests that memorial donations be made to Mt. Zion Baptist Church, Building Fund.
